Brazil vs Chile: World Cup head-to-head record

Last updated

Brazil holds a commanding World Cup record against Chile with 3 wins and 1 draw in their 4 all-time meetings from 1962 to 2014, never losing to La Roja on football's biggest stage. The Seleção has outscored Chile 12-5 across these encounters, demonstrating their historical superiority in World Cup competition.

Their most recent meeting came in the dramatic 2014 Round of 16, where Brazil advanced 3-2 on penalties after a 1-1 draw, while their highest-scoring clash was the 1962 semi-final that Brazil won 4-2 on home soil.

Complete World Cup Head-to-Head Record

The Brazil-Chile World Cup rivalry spans over five decades, with their first meeting in the 1962 semi-final on Brazilian soil. Brazil's 4-2 victory in that match remains their highest-scoring encounter, setting the tone for decades of dominance. The most recent clash in 2014 proved the most dramatic, requiring penalties to separate the teams after a 1-1 draw.

YearStageResultScore
1962Semi-finalsBrazil win4-2
1998Round of 16Brazil win4-1
2010Round of 16Brazil win3-0
2014Round of 16Draw (Brazil win on pens)1-1 (3-2 pens)

Frequently asked questions

How many times have Brazil and Chile met in the World Cup?

Brazil and Chile have met 4 times in World Cup competition between 1962 and 2014, with Brazil winning 3 matches and drawing 1.

What was Brazil's biggest World Cup win over Chile?

Brazil's biggest World Cup victory over Chile was 3-0 in the 2010 Round of 16, though they also won 4-2 in 1962 and 4-1 in 1998.

When did Brazil and Chile last meet in the World Cup?

Their last World Cup meeting was in the 2014 Round of 16, where Brazil won 3-2 on penalties after a 1-1 draw in regular time.
